I recommend installing a config, configs tone down the graphics farther than the in-game options allow, improving FPS.
Here is a good config used by a comp player: http://pastebin.com/jQ2STNJd

Here are instructions.
How to install
Open file explorer and go here: C:\Users\YourUserName\Documents\My Games\UnrealEngine3\ShooterGame\Config

Make a backup of your ShooterEngine.ini and save it wherever you want, just make sure it’s accessible in-case something goes wrong.

Open up both the ShooterEngine.ini still in your config folder (that you made a backup of) and the downloaded config file at the same time.

Hold Ctrl+A in the Original ShooterEngine.ini and delete everything, now copy and paste in the stuff from the downloaded config.

Save it.

Right click on the ShooterEngine.ini -> properties -> set it to read only.
